Program and Dinner Menu from the wedding of Donald J. Trump and Melania Knauss Trump at Mar-a-Lago on January 22, 2005.
Includes the four-page Wedding Program at The Episcopal Church of Bethesda-by-the-Sea in Palm Beach and the dinner menu at Mar-a-Lago. Both pieces printed on heavy cardstock. Housed in custom blue cloth clamshell, title stamped in gilt on front cover. From the archive of Virginia Loving, with her name printed on the menu. The Wedding Program includes a list of speakers and members of the wedding party, a notable list of individuals from the Trump family.

Donald Trump and Melania Knauss were married on January 22, 2005, at the Episcopal Church of Bethesda-by-the-Sea in Palm Beach, Florida. The reception took place at Mar-a-Lago. The guest list included high-profile figures such as Bill and Hillary Clinton, Rudy Giuliani, Barbara Walters, Heidi Klum, Simon Cowell, Billy Joel, and Shaquille O’Neal. Elton John performed at the event. The estimated cost of the wedding was around $1 million.
